Maple Tree Pruning in Allentown, PA
Maple tree pruning services involve carefully trimming and shaping maple trees to promote healthy growth, improve appearance, and maintain safety on residential properties. This service typically covers a range of projects, including removing dead or diseased branches, reducing the size of overgrown limbs, and shaping the canopy to enhance the tree’s structure. Homeowners often seek these services to prevent potential hazards from falling branches, improve sunlight exposure, or simply maintain the aesthetic appeal of their landscape.
Before requesting maple tree pruning, property owners should consider the overall health and age of the tree, as well as any specific goals for the pruning project. It’s important to understand the best time of year for pruning to avoid damaging the tree and to clarify the scope of work, such as whether only certain branches will be removed or if shaping will be involved. Proper planning ensures the tree’s health is preserved and that the results align with the property owner’s landscape objectives.

Common Maple Tree Pruning Jobs
Maple Tree Pruning Services - shaping and thinning to maintain healthy growth and appearance.
Structural Pruning - removing dead or weak branches to prevent damage during storms.
Crown Reduction - reducing the size of the canopy to improve clearance and safety.
Thinning - selectively removing branches for better air circulation and light penetration.
Deadwood Removal - eliminating decayed or broken branches to promote tree health.
Formative Pruning - guiding young trees to develop strong, balanced structures.
Maple Tree Pruning Questions
Why is tree pruning important for maple trees? Proper pruning helps maintain the health and structure of maple trees, encouraging strong growth and reducing the risk of damage from storms or disease.
When is the best time to prune a maple tree? The ideal time for pruning is during late winter or early spring before new growth begins, ensuring minimal stress on the tree.
What types of pruning services are available for maples? Services typically include crown thinning, shaping, deadwood removal, and safety pruning to remove hazardous branches.
How can pruning improve the appearance of a maple tree? Pruning can enhance the tree’s shape, promote fuller growth, and improve overall aesthetics of the landscape.
